Senior professionals don’t just appear.
They become senior through years of practice, mistakes, and experience.

If AI eliminates junior roles, we’re not just cutting entry-level jobs. We’re cutting off the very path that creates future seniors.

No juniors → no seniors.
It’s that simple.

Ever messaged a recruiter, only to find out they couldn’t actually help you with your request? Well, you’re not alone. Not all recruiters are the same, and knowing the difference can save you time (and frustration). Before you hit “Connect” or “Message,” make sure you’re knocking on the right door.
→ Internal recruiter = jobs in one company
→ Agency recruiter = jobs across many companies
→ Independent recruiter = personal networks and industry focus
→ Headhunter = executive and hard-to-find roles
→ Career coach = guidance and strategy
